Event Time03/18/2009 - 2:00pm - 3:00pmDescriptionA Revolutionary Approach to Potty Training Before Age 2! Myth: It’s easier and healthier to potty train your baby if you wait until around age 2 or 3. Fact: The truth is, potty training a baby under the age of 24 months is actually easier than potty training an older child. Why? Because as children get older, they want to make more and more decisions on their own. This natural progression towards independence is healthy, but it also often sets the stage for a battle of wills when it comes to potty training. By helping babies learn simple potty-time signs, the Baby Signs® Potty Training Program makes it easy for parents to both begin and end the whole enterprise before age 2.
